The Role:
We’re hiring an experienced Artist Growth & Development Lead to work closely with select artists on their release timelines, live bookings, strategy, and team coordination.
What You’ll Do
- Book shows and tours, liaise with venues, promoters, and agents
- Plan and lead release campaigns, from rollout planning to execution
- Oversee Spotify promotion and targeted ad campaigns
- Manage release plans, deadlines, and project timelines
- Contribute to creative direction, content planning, and merch strategy
- Coordinate between visual designers, editors and graphic designers
- Support monetization efforts (sync, merch, live, digital)
What You Bring
- 5+ years of experience in artist management, live bookings, or music marketing
- A strong track record of running successful campaigns and managing artist growth
- Excellent communication skills, you know how to keep artists and teams in sync
- High emotional intelligence, you can read the room, build trust, and lead with empathy
- Proactive mindset, you take initiative, anticipate needs, and keep things moving
- A true team player, you collaborate well, delegate when needed, and step up when it counts
- Bonus: design, content editing, or merch production skills are a plus
